Bruce Feldman of Fox Sports and The Athletic is reporting that Notre Dame special teams coordinator Brian Polian is joining Brian Kelly's staff at LSU.

The 46-year old coach has been the special team's coordinator at Notre Dame since 2017. Prior to that, he was the head coach at Nevada from 2013-2016.

Before taking the Nevada job, Polian was the special team's coordinator and tight ends coach at Texas A&M during the 2012-2013 season.

Polian's father is former NFL executive Bill Polian.

The Polian hire means that LSU special teams coordinator Greg McMahon will not be retained. McMahon was hired by Ed Orgeron in 2017.
